Setup 


System Requirements 

Mac OS X 10.10 or greater 



Thunderbolt™-equipped Mac 

4GB minimum RAM, 8GB Recommended 



 

Download and Install Element Software package 

Before Element will work with the computer, special software must be installed. Always get the latest version of the software 

from the apogee website: 

www.apogeedigital.com/support/element

 

 



 

The download comes in the form of a .dmg file. Open it to view the contents. 

Inside you will find three items: 

 



Element Release Notes.pdf 



Element Uninstaller.app 



Element Installer.pkg 

 

 



 

 

 



Double-click to launch the 

Element Installer.pkg​. A dialog box will appear with a series of steps to proceed. Follow the 

prompts to complete the installation. You will be required to restart your computer. 

 

As a result of the software install: 





Element Control software is placed in the Mac’s Applications folder 



When connected, the Element Thunderbolt interface appears as an audio input/output device in Mac System 

Preferences > Sound 



Element Firmware Updater.app is placed in the Mac’s Applications > Utilities folder.

Connect Element to Your Computer 



 

1.

Connect the Power Supply to Element. 



 

2.

Connect Element to your Mac using a Thunderbolt cable. 



 

 

If connecting a Second Element 



1.

Connect the Power Supply to Element 

2.

Connect Element to a second Thunderbolt port on your Mac. 



3.

Connect optical cables from the Optical Out of one Element, to the Optical In of the second Element. 

If second unit is Element 24 & 46 - Two optical cables required 



If connecting two Element 88 units - Four optical cables required

Update Element’s Firmware 



When first connecting Element to your computer, you may be prompted to update the Firmware: 

 

 



1.

Click Update, or manually open the Element 

Firmware Updater.app from your computer’s 

Applications > Utilities folder. 

 

 

 



 

2.

Make sure only one Element is connected to the 



Mac. Then click Start Update. 

 

3.



Follow any prompts that may appear. 

 

4.



When it says Element is up to date, you can quit 

the updater.

Element Control 



Control of your Apogee Element Thunderbolt interface is available through a Mac software app, an iOS control app, or the 

Remote control surface. Each provides it’s own unique set of controls and features. 

Element Control Mac Software 

When Element Control for Mac software is opened, you are presented with a Snapshot Template chooser. 

 

 

 



Each Snapshot Template is a starting point that provides the most common feature set needed for various workflows. These 

default Snapshot Templates and examples of their use are explained further on 

page 24


. A snapshot can be customized to 

your specific needs and saved as a user-snapshot. Here is an explanation of all the features and components of Element 

Control Software: 

 

Element Control consists of four windows: 



1.

Essentials 

2.

Primary 


3.

Hover Help 

4.

Remote

Essentials Window 



This window provides simple and compact controls for Input Channels and Outputs. It’s orientation can be changed between 

vertical and horizontal so that it can be placed to the side or end of your recording software. 

  

 

 



1.

Orientation Button

​ - Switches the Essentials window between horizontal and vertical view. 

2.

Analog Input Channels

​ - Provides settings for the analog inputs. 

The buttons at the bottom correspond to the Input Channel Settings: Phantom Power (48V), Group (G), Soft 



Limit (SL), and Polarity Invert (⌀) 

3.

Outputs

​ - Headphones and speaker outputs settings are provided. 

The buttons at the bottom correspond to the Output controls: Mute (M), Dimminish (D), Sum-to-Mono (Σ) 



4.

Clear Meters

​ - Clear the Peak or Hold indicators from the level meters. 



5.

Talkback 

​- Engages talkback to communicate with artists wearing headphones. Set the Talkback source and 

destination in the System Sidebar. 

6.

Mute All

​ - Mutes Headphones and Speakers outputs of the Element Thunderbolt interface. To unmute, click the 

individual headphone or speaker mute buttons.
